Metal-Clad Switchgear Overview
Definition
Metal-clad switchgear is a kind of electrical equipment. It uses metal barriers to keep its main parts apart and safe. This design helps protect people and machines from electrical problems. Inside, each compartment has metal walls that are grounded. These walls stop electrical arcs and make repairs safer. Metal-clad switchgear is not like other types. It uses these barriers to make things safer and more reliable.

Main Components
Metal-clad switchgear has many important parts. Each part does a special job to keep the system safe and working well.
Main Compartments in Metal-Clad Switchgear:
The front compartment holds the circuit breaker.
The top compartment has the bus bar assembly.
The rear compartment keeps the current transformer and cable connections.
The table below lists the main parts and features in metal-clad switchgear:
Component/Feature
Description
Compartmentalized design
Metal barriers split up the main parts inside the box.
Drawout circuit breakers
Breakers can be pulled out from the front for easy fixing.
Current transformers (CTs)
Devices that check how much current is flowing.
Potential transformers (PTs)
Units that measure voltage and can be taken out for service.
Busbar configuration
Busbars have special covers and connections for extra safety.
Heat dissipation
Busbar supports help get rid of heat and make things stronger during faults.
Maintenance safety
Ground ball studs let workers do repairs safely.
Infrared viewing ports
Optional ports let workers look inside with infrared tools.

How Metal Clad Switchgear Works
Operation Principles
Metal clad switchgear has a special design with separate compartments. Each main part sits in its own metal box. This keeps the circuit breaker, busbars, and cables apart. The metal barriers stop electrical problems from spreading. Workers can fix one part while the rest stays on. This helps keep power running during repairs or checks.

Maintenance and Durability
Switchgear lasts a long time if you take care of it. Yufeng Electric Co., Ltd checks every unit to make sure it works in hard places. Cleaning, checking, and oiling help stop problems. Workers should look for loose parts and change old ones.
Clean, check, tighten, oil, and use switchgear parts often.
Move circuit breakers by hand each year to keep them clean.
Make a plan to look for damage or rust.
The metal box and busbars in metal-clad switchgear can last 15 to 30 years. Some switchgear works for over 50 years. Low-voltage switchgear lasts 20 to 30 years. High-voltage switchgear can last more than 40 years. Metal-enclosed switchgear may not last as long in rough places.

Switchgear Comparison
Metal-Clad vs. Metal-Enclosed
Metal-clad and metal-enclosed switchgear are not the same. Metal-clad switchgear has metal barriers between each part. These barriers help keep workers safe. They also stop problems from spreading. Metal-enclosed switchgear has shared spaces inside. This means it gives less protection. The table below shows how they are different:
Feature
Metal-Clad Switchgear
Metal-Enclosed Switchgear
Cost
Higher at first, better long-term value
Lower at first, but higher repair costs
Space Needs
Needs more room for setup
Compact, fits tight spaces
Best Use
Factories, data centers, substations
Commercial buildings, small industries
Voltage Levels
For medium voltage applications (1kV to 38kV)
For low voltage (below 1kV)
Upgrades
Modular, easy to upgrade
Harder to upgrade, may need full replacement
Metal-clad switchgear is safer than metal-enclosed switchgear. Metal-clad types follow IEEE C37.20.2 rules. Metal-enclosed types follow IEEE C37.20.3 rules. Metal-clad switchgear uses draw-out breakers. These breakers can be pulled out for fixing. Metal-enclosed switchgear usually has fixed breakers.
Metal-Clad vs. Open Switchgear
Metal-clad and open switchgear are also very different. Metal-clad switchgear covers live parts with shutters and barriers. Open switchgear leaves parts open. This makes shock or arc flash more likely. Metal-clad switchgear has interlocks and arc-resistant designs. These features help keep workers safe. Open switchgear does not have these safety tools.
Arc-resistant design keeps problems in one spot.
Interlocks stop unsafe moves.
Good insulation and grounding lower shock risks.
With metal-clad switchgear, you can work on one part safely. The rest of the system can stay on. Open switchgear makes workers get close to live parts. This is not as safe.
